Engaging your board for communications projects is essential for ensuring the success of your organization’s messaging and branding efforts. A strong board can provide guidance, expertise, and resources to support your communications strategy and help you effectively reach your target audience.
The first step in engaging your board for communications projects is to clearly communicate the importance of effective communication in achieving your organization’s goals. Explain how a well thought-out communications strategy can help raise awareness, expand your reach, and strengthen your brand. Emphasize the impact that effective messaging can have on fundraising, partnerships, and overall success.
Next, involve your board in the planning and development of your communications projects. Seek input from board members on key messaging, target audiences, and communication channels. Encourage them to share their expertise and connections to help you reach and engage with stakeholders effectively.
Additionally, make sure to provide regular updates and progress reports to your board on the status of your communications projects. Keep them informed of any successes, challenges, and upcoming initiatives. This will help to keep them engaged and invested in the success of your communications efforts.
Furthermore, leverage the unique skills and experiences of your board members to enhance your communications projects. For example, if you have board members with experience in marketing, public relations, or social media, enlist their help in developing and implementing your communications strategy. Their expertise can provide valuable insights and guidance to help you achieve your goals.
Lastly, recognize and appreciate the contributions of your board in supporting your communications projects. Show gratitude for their time, efforts, and support in helping to advance your organization’s communication goals. This will help to foster a strong and collaborative relationship with your board, ensuring continued engagement and support for your communications efforts.
